[Spring Security] COMTNSECURED_RESOURCES 및 COMTNSECURED_RESOURCES_ROLE 테이블 존재하지 않다고 나올때
2017. 7. 18. 17:44ㆍIT개발/Spring & Spring Security
반응형
전자정부 3.6버전내용 중 Spring Security 관련 설정 정보에서 존재하지 않는 테이블이 있어 다음과 같이 변경하였더니 오류가 없었다.
context-security.xml
before |
sqlRegexMatchedRequestMapping=" SELECT a.resource_pattern uri, b.authority authority FROM COMTNSECURED_RESOURCES a, COMTNSECURED_RESOURCES_ROLE b WHERE a.resource_id = b.resource_id AND a.resource_type = 'url'" |
after |
sqlRegexMatchedRequestMapping=" SELECT a.ROLE_PTTRN uri, b.AUTHOR_CODE authority FROM COMTNROLEINFO a, COMTNAUTHORROLERELATE b WHERE a.ROLE_CODE = b.ROLE_CODE AND a.ROLE_TY = 'regex' ORDER BY a.ROLE_SORT" |
참고 자료 1. https://open.egovframe.go.kr/cop/bbs/selectBoardArticle.do?bbsId=BBSMSTR_000000000013&nttId=19027
반응형